""A colossal, deceased monster of unknown origin whose corpse is now haven for some of the most bizarre fauna in Minegarde. Alongside the masses of giant fungi that can grow as tall as the tallest trees, the area emits a purple and blue glow via the foxfire from the the swarms of fungi. The various water pools have multitudes of different properties within, as well as large amounts of phosphorescence from suspended algae. Even with hard research via the Guild, the deceased monster is completely unknown and has no documents on it - all that's known is that it was possibly large enough to squash giant mountains flat into a mess of debris just by simply treading.""

The Mycelium Hills is an island that was once a colossal monster a long time ago. What remains now is the deceased body and the mass swarmings of saprophytes, consuming and littering each sector of the deceased body with mycelium. This area is characterized by large, tree-sized mushrooms that are bioluminescent due to the extreme levels of foxfire. The terrain ranges from dense fungal forests to vast grassy plains to linear ravines to high altitude ridges that enable a high viewpoint of the entire zone


Areas[]

Mycelium Hills Map By TheElusiveOne

 









Base Camp: The camp is on a miniature cliffside with the sky having a black hue and the giant mushrooms glowing blue, cyan, turqoise and green. The opposite way of the base camp is a view of the coasts of the island. 

Area 1: Past two giant fungi leads to a large, open-ended area with a few giant mushrooms around, a medium sized lake on the left and fields of violet shaded vegetation on the right, Status effect fungi are on the far right and mid-way of the area. 

Area 2: An even larger, open-ended area with fields on the right, much more dense levels of giant mushrooms: with taller mushrooms too  match and another medium sized lake on the left. 

Area 3: The largest area in the zone with giant mushrooms everywhere alongside dense, levels of violet colored vegetation. Some of the giant mushrooms in this area can be climbed upon and gain access to a higher altitude part of the map. Status effect fungi are sporadically around this area. 

Area 4: An area blocked off by a medium sized ravine side on the edge of the map though there is a small sector on the left side that can be climbed upon to view the coasts of the island from that area. There are three medium sized pools placed near each other alongside half-sized giant mushrooms on the edges of the pools. 

Area 5: The giant mushrooms in this area shine pink and purple in comparison to blue, an open-ended but also streamlined area that leads into a high altitude ridged sector which requires climbing. The place is littered with Mycelium huts that frequently spawn Mycelians, this can be stopped by hitting and destroying the huts. Once to the top of the high altitude part of the area, unique vegetation with eyes and with large mushrooms present but one center one featuring window-esque holes in it are present alongside navy blue vines, tied around it, shaped as if it was done manually. The coasts and overview of the Mycelium Hills map is viewable here, similarly to the Great Forest overview being viewable through the Great Forest Peaks.
